              Notepad++
Notepad++ is a widely-used free and open-source text and source code editor for Windows. Built on the Scintilla editing component, it offers a rich set of features for programmers, including syntax highlighting for multiple languages, code folding, macro recording, and a tabbed interface for managing multiple files efficiently. Its lightweight design ensures fast performance even with large files. by Don Ho
 
              Mousepad
Mousepad is a straightforward yet capable text editor designed specifically for the Xfce desktop environment. It provides essential text editing functionalities in a lightweight package, making it an excellent choice for everyday tasks and basic code editing.
